Roland Announces Second 808-Inspired PUMA Sneaker

Roland and PUMA are going to drop a new pair of TR-808 inspired sneakers, the RS-100, on #808DAY. Here's what you need to know about this brand new shoe.

The concept Mi-Adidas TR-808 sneakers from Neely & Daughters we featured in 2017 were super popular. However, despite their best efforts, Roland decided on going it alone with Puma as their partners. It could be argued that the concept trainers by Margo Neely have unwittingly paved the way for the Roland and Puma collaboration to celebrate the iconic TR-808 drum machine with the RS-0 earlier this year.

Just a few months later, Roland and Puma have announced another new pair of shoes inspired by the TR-808 which are more colorful and vibrant. Here's the official press release on the Puma RS-100s... just in time for 808 day (8th August):

Los Angeles, CA, July 20, 2018 — Roland Corporation has teamed up with the global sports brand PUMA to unbox a second new TR-808-inspired sneaker, the PUMA RS-100 Roland. Roland’s partnership with PUMA kicked off earlier this year with the unveiling of their first sneaker collaboration, PUMA’s RS-0 Roland, also inspired by the legendary 808 drum machine.   

PUMA’s RS-100 Roland follows the story of reinvention—inspired by the past, shaped by the colorful histories of both brands and reimagined for the future. While the RS-0 Roland is a complete reboot of PUMA’s classic ‘80s R-System line of running sneakers, the new RS-100 Roland retains a more retro look but decked in modern materials.   
The upper of the RS-100 Roland features a vibrant orange suede Formstrip with white reflective edges amidst a combination of white-red pebble leather, black ripstop nylon panels and yellow suede. PUMA and Roland branding can be found on the tongue label, the footbed and the anodized metal hangtag. “Rhythm Composer TR-808, Computer Composer” is printed on the heel. A PUMA and Roland logo is printed on the footbed while the outsole features lines that mimic the lights on a synthesizer. All colors and detailing represent ‘80s retro hues found on a Roland TR-808 drum machine.  

Unveiled last spring, the RS-0 Roland, also inspired by the game-changing TR-808 drum machine, features premium leather black upper, micro perf vents, 6mm flat, reflective laces, reflective midsole details and signature TR-808 colors – red, orange and yellow – on the Formstrip. Familiar notes like “Rhythm Composer” and “Bass Drum” accent the midsole while the orange hue continues to the translucent rubber outsole. PUMA and Roland branding can be found on the tongue label, footbed and the anodized metal hangtag.

Both the RS-0 and RS-100 Roland sneakers drop globally on August 8, 2018, internationally known as #808DAY. The iconic TR-808 drum machine is celebrated for its legendary status and credited by many as the spark that lit the flame of hip-hop music worldwide.   

RS-0 and RS-100 sneakers can be purchased starting August 8, 2018, at PUMA.com, at PUMA stores and through leading retailers.  

Style Name: PUMA RS-100 Roland
Colorway: PUMA Black-PUMA White-Vibrant orange
Retail Price: US $100 / EUR 110
